Sinopsis

The middle-east is boiling over, conventional weapons are not working and the nuclear option is not politically correct. A glamorous Swedish surgeon and a British boffin are following different paths to find a solution. The story takes us from America via Europe to the Arab hot-spots and a literary agent is struggling to separate fact from fiction. How will the world survive?Mike Launer has been practising psychiatry all his life, dealing with all manner of suffering from emaciated young girls to malicious murderers. This is his third novel in different genres ranging from the more familiar mad psychiatrists to cowboys and Indians and now political intrigue. All of them have a mixture of humour and suffering with a dose of humanity.
